No mandatory evacuation order imminent

July 11, 2008, about 9:00 pm...

Just back from the Community Fire Information Meeting, held at 6:00 pm at Tularcitos School in Carmel Valley.

I'll have audio up on KUSP tomorrow and notes from the meeting sometime tonight. But the bottom line is that, for the moment, the evacuation ADVISORY for our area has been upgraded to a VOLUNTARY evacuation - and, as of now, there is nothing imminent that would turn the VOLUNTARY evacuation order into a MANDATORY evacuation order.

Mira!

On the way home this evening, a group looking like they were removing the telescope and its mount from Mira Observatory broke down just past the Cachagua Grade turnoff. I stopped to ask if they needed help, but they had all that they required.

I hope the observatory survives!
